After achieving the remarkable feat of becoming Brazil’s all-time leading goal scorer with 78 goals, Neymar has unveiled a special, limited-edition pair of customized shoes dedicated to those who have been instrumental in his career.

Earning his place as the highest-scoring player in the history of the Brazilian national team, Neymar decided to commemorate this achievement with a brand-new, personalized shoe model. Taking to social media, he introduced this exclusive footwear, which is being released in a limited run of 78 pairs, symbolizing his new goal-scoring record. These shoes will be gifted to individuals who have played pivotal roles in Neymar’s career.

According to Neymar’s announcement, the recipients of these special editions will include close friends, coaches, current and former teammates, as well as Brazilian football legends.

Each pair of these shoes corresponds to one of Neymar’s goals for the national team. Dubbed the “NJR 78 Future,” the shoe design features a pristine white color and showcases ten unique logos, crafted from Neymar’s personal sketches.

These illustrations start on the right shoe with an image of a young player and conclude with a depiction of a contemporary player on the left shoe. Surrounding these images are the poignant words, “History does not repeat itself.” Additionally, Neymar’s original childhood signature, the one he jotted down in a notebook while dreaming of a career as a professional footballer, adorns the front of the shoes.
